      The #FDroid website has a new banner on top to remind visitors that #Google did not change course and #Android will be locked-down in under 200 days.

      If you care about the freedom to control your devices and care about the privacy of you data, please contact your representative and make your voice heard.

      https://keepandroidopen.org/ (thanks @marcprux) has the resources to guide you.

      We know users will rarely visit the site so the Client(s) will get a banner soon too.

      Thank you for your support!

                            @fdroidorg @marcprux And while the banner correctly states F-Droid being under threat: it's not just F-Droid, it's the free Android world being under threat. In its entirety. So the same applies to IzzyOnDroid – but also to Obtainium & Co. And if you think you could still use Aurora to access the PlayStore, think again: how would you install Aurora in the first place?

                            This is the empire striking. The alleged "security" is just a way to circumvent the requirement to open for alternative stores.

                                      @2something @fdroidorg @marcprux 1. I believe that it's specifically about stalkerware that gets distributed as sideloaded, anonymously signed APKs to avoid detection by Google Play Protect. I think this change will have a significant positive impact on the stalkerware market and result in a reduction in technology-facilitated intimate partner violence, making it a worthy tradeoff. Most open-source projects are not developed anonymously, and if developers don't want to get a certificate, nothing stops a third-party marketplace like F-Droid from building a signed, distributable APK for them. The same people complaining about this have already built the solution. "I'm altering the deal, pray I don't alter it further" just feels entitled and missing the point entirely.
                                      2. I would specifically get a phone with an unlocked bootloader, because I want to run free and open source software on it, as I already have. I don't want other people tampering with my phone and requiring messing with the bootloader and performing a factory reset (which i would notice) to sideload untrusted apps is a security feature I want.

                                      If you don't like it, try coming up with a better solution, or you know, try doing some work with victims of stalking by intimate partners to realize it is actually a much bigger problem for them than whatever spying Google Play Services is doing.
